[quote=Anonymous]Abortion is prohibited by an extrabiblical early 2nd century Christian text called the Didache. So it's not scripture, but it's tradition for the Roman Catholic, Eastern Catholic, and Orthodox churches dating back to the early church. Sola scriptura Protestants who are divorced from the early church traditions cannot defend their abortion stance using the bible or church tradition. In fact, in the 70s before the rise of the religious right, most protestant churches were not anti-abortion.[/quote]
